- BUSINESS OR ORGANIZATION REPRESENTATION:
The .cn top-level domain space is intended for businesses and organizations
and not for individual use. By registering a .CN domain name, you hereby
represent that you have registered the domain name on behalf of a business
or organization.

- MAXIMUM TERM:
The maximum term for a domain name registration in the .CN TLD shall be five
(5) years. Domain Name Registrations shall be available for terms of one,
two, three, four and five years.
- PROHIBITED USES FOR .CN DOMAIN NAME.
Registrant may not register or use a domain name that is deemed by CNNIC
to:
- Be against the basic principles prescribed in the Constitution of the
Peoples Republic of China ("PRC");
- Jeopardize national security, leak state secrets, intend to overturn
the government, or disrupt of state integrity of the PRC;
- Harm national honor and national interests of the PRC;
- Instigate hostility or discrimination between different nationalities,
or disrupt the national solidarity of the PRC;
- Violate the PRC's religion policies or propagate cult and feudal superstition;
- Spread rumors, disturb public order or disrupt social stability of
the PRC;
- Spread pornography, obscenity, gambling, violence, homicide, terror
or instigate crimes in the PRC;
- Insult, libel against others and infringe other people's legal rights
and interests in the PRC; or
- Take any other action prohibited in laws, rules and administrative
regulations of the PRC.
